London – Producer and distributor Power has recently confirmed a pan-regional deal with NBC Universal (Asia) across 23 territories. Titles included in the deal, which amount to almost 50 hours from Power’s co-production slate are the 13 part action-adventure series Crusoe, which recently aired on NBC in the US and The Day of the Triffids, the epic apocalyptic drama currently filming in the UK for the BBC. The pan regional deal follows the pan regional output deal secured with Fox Middle East in 2008, which includes over 90 mini series and TV movies (around 300 hours). This deal represents the first opportunity for Power to partner with Fox. In addition to Power’s catalogue of completed titles, Fox have picked up all future Power co-productions over the coming three years. George Sakkalli, Power’s VP, Asian sales and distribution, who brokered the deals said, “These are the first in a series of new partnerships we have developed as a foundation to our continued growth in Asia and The Middle East. We are delighted to be working with such far-reaching broadcasters.”
